Output 8fb533274cb11cfa96b6894181d58713fd95e8222f325c82b153bc9c54db88c0:2

value
51130656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ddbf17fa166c185e81148a8fdfb5e8bab445b450 OP_EQUALVERIFY OP_CHECKSIG
address
1MDVFpFu46BUp41oXYqu91cgwML7ieXGWr
transaction
8fb533274cb11cfa96b6894181d58713fd95e8222f325c82b153bc9c54db88c0
spent
true